On December 12, 2009 at 10:38 pm WebChickens can safely eat mac and cheese. However, as with all foods, it’s important to offer mac and cheese in moderation. Too much of any one food can lead to nutritional imbalances and obesity in chickens. So, if you’re going to offer your chickens mac and cheese, be sure to do so in moderation and offer a variety of other foods as well. ...

WebFeb 18, 2024 · Can Chickens Eat Mac And Cheese? It is not recommended to feed mac and cheese to chickens on a regular basis. Mac and cheese typically contains high levels of fat, salt, and carbohydrates, which are not essential to a chicken’s diet and can cause health problems if consumed in excess. ...
